Forecast: Total Sharks, Rays, Chimaeras Production in Capture Fisheries for Human Consumption in Italy

Based on the forecasted data, the production of sharks, rays, and chimaeras in Italian capture fisheries for human consumption is set to increase steadily from 2024 to 2028. Compared to the previous years, where the estimated actual capture output stood at 5.1 million Euros in 2023, the expected production value in 2024 is 5.3839 million Euros, with subsequent year-on-year increases of approximately 4.39% by 2025, 4.15% by 2026, 3.96% by 2027, and 3.76% by 2028. The projected five-year compound annual growth rate (CAGR) is approximately 4.06%.
